    Put the adjectives in the correct order before the nouns.

  • She went home and sat on her [ huge / white / modern / comfortable ] sofa.
    comfortable huge modern white

  • He has a [ silver / old / beautiful ] ring.
    beautiful old silver

  • He wants some [ Italian / delicious ] cheese.
    delicious Italian

  • We ate some [ green / round / English ] apples.
    round green English

  • I visited a [ old / huge / brown / German / spooky ] castle.
    spooky huge old brown German
